The number of kindergartens in Uzbekistan has exceeded 38 thousand

Growth in the preschool education sector is being observed in Uzbekistan, the National Statistics Committee reported.

By the end of 2024, the number of operating preschool educational institutions in the country reached 38,058. This figure exceeds that of 2023 by more than 2,000, indicating a steady expansion of the system.

According to the data, the majority of kindergartens — more than 28,700 — are family-based non-governmental institutions. In recent years, the active growth of this sector has been driven by government support for the private sector and the simplification of licensing procedures.

The largest number of kindergartens is located in the Samarkand (4,507), Andijan (4,324), Kashkadarya (4,216), and Fergana (4,189) regions. The lowest figures are recorded in Tashkent city (1,047) and Syrdarya region (1,145).

Experts note that the increase in the number of kindergartens contributes to early childhood development and improves the quality of education. At the same time, raising teachers’ qualifications and strengthening quality control remain key priorities.
